Description
Research and discover zero-day vulnerabilities in cloud and on-prem environments and associated technologies. Develop and implement proof-of-concept exploits to demonstrate potential risks and work closely with engineering teams to address findings. Design mitigations at scale for found vulnerabilities and work with engineering teams to integrate these mitigations. Collaborate with cross-functional teams to assess the impact of identified threats and propose mitigation strategies. Provide detailed reports outlining vulnerabilities, exploitation techniques, and recommended remediation steps. Create and maintain cutting-edge vulnerability discovery, exploitation, and penetration testing tools. Stay abreast of the latest security research and integrate innovative techniques into the offensive security toolkit. Collaborate with internal security teams to enhance overall security posture, including incident response and defensive security. Participate in knowledge-sharing initiatives, mentor junior team members, and contribute to the security community. Proven track record of discovering and responsibly disclosing security vulnerabilities. Expertise in any of the following domains: Cloud security: Azure, AWS, GCP. Kubernetes and container security Virtualization and VM isolation IOT security AI security SENIOR: 6+ years of hands-on experience in offensive security research, with 2+ years of focus on cloud environments. SWE II: 4+ years of hands-on experience in offensive security research, with 2+ years of focus on cloud environments. Proficiency in multiple programming and scripting languages. Bachelor's degree or equivalent in Computer Science, Information Security, or related field. Advanced degrees are a plus. Strong written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to convey complex security concepts to both technical and non-technical audiences.
